#264b03 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#264b03 is composed of 14.9% red, 29.4%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 96% yellow and 70.6% black. It has a hue angle of 90.8 degrees, a saturation of 92.3% and a lightness of 15.3%. #264b03 color hex could be obtained by blending #4c9606 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

#264b03 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#264b03 has RGB values of R:38, G:75,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0, Y:0.96, K:0.71. Its decimal value is 2509571.
